                清華大學環境學院研究生導師文湘華介紹如下:

                姓  名: 文湘華
                所在單位: 水環境保護教研所
                職  稱: 正高級
                郵寄地址: 清華大學環境學院
                辦公電話: 86-10-62772837
                電子郵件: xhwen@tsinghua.edu.cn
                辦公地點: 清華大學環境學院

                教育背景

                博士研究生 清華大學環境工程系 1986.8—1990.8

                碩士研究生 清華大學環境工程系 1983.9—1986.7

                助理工程師 北京市市政工程設計院 1982.8—1983.8

                本科生 北京建筑工程學院,市政工程系 1978.9—1982.7

                工作履歷

                2011.01—現在           清華大學環境學院  教授                 

                1996.12—2011.01    清華大學環境科學與工程系 副教授,教授

                1998.08—1998.10    英國 Leeds 大學土木工程系 訪問學者  

                1992.04—1996.12    中國科學院生態環境研究中心  助理研究員, 副研究員  

                1993.11—1994.06    美國Delaware大學土木工程系 訪問學者  

                1990.08—1992.04    中國科學院生態環境研究中心 客座研究

                教學:

                《現代環境生物學》 研究生課程

                學術兼職國際水協(IWA)會員

                中國微生物學會會員

                研究領域

                1.水污染控制理論與技術

                2.高效微生物及其酶

                3.高效生物反應器

                4.微生物群落結構

                研究概況

                科技部863項目:再生水回用的風險控制技術研究(2008AA062502),2008-2011

                國家重大水專項:城市污水處理廠與排水管網優化技術集成與示范(2009ZX07313-003),2009-2011

                科技部863項目:重大環境污染事件特征污染物檢測系統與技術集成(2009AA06A417),2009-2011

                科技部863項目:新型膜材料及膜組器的制備和應用關鍵技術與工程示范(2009AA062901),2009-2012

                國家自然科學基金委: 城市污水處理系統中氨氧化古菌的富集與動力學特性,2011-2013

                清華大學自主科研項目: 污水處理廠碳源高效富集轉化與資源能源化技術原理研究, (2010THZ02),  2011-2012

                獎勵與榮譽清華之友—優秀青年教師,二等獎,1998

                清華之友—優秀青年教師群體獎,1999

                管式膜生物反應器設計,《中國給水排水》優秀論文,一等獎,2000

                Surface Complexation model (ES & T),ISI? Citation Classic Award,2000

                水體顆粒物及難降解有機物的特性及控制技術原理,中國科學院自然科學獎,一等獎,2001

                一體式膜-生物反應器處理生活污水的試驗研究,北京市科技進步獎,三等獎,2001

                膜生物反應器廢水處理特性及機理的研究,國家教育部自然科學獎,一等獎,2002

                難降解有機工業廢水高新生物處理技術與關鍵設備,北京市科技進步獎, 一等獎,2002, 2008

                有毒有害廢水高新生物處理技術,國家科技進步獎, 二等獎,2003, 2009
